Jeremy Weiss wrote:
> I've just set up my first MySQL server for a desktop application at work.
> I've got it up and the desktop app works fine from the computer MySQL is on.
> However, I can't for the life of me get a DSN connection (ODBC) to work from
> the other computers on the LAN.
> 
> I've tried using all the following as the Server in the ODBC box.
> 
> 192.168.1.136
> 192.168.1.136\mysql
> \\D7s54y91
> \\D7s54y91\mysql
> 
> And the error I get everytime is "Unknown MySQL server host"

1 What app are you using?

2 What dsn works on the server machine?

3 Are you certain that the server allows outside connections to the 
MySQL server? 3306 is the default port for MySQL (AFAIK). Perhaps 
there's a firewall there?
